Software Engineer

4 Weeks ago • All levels • DevOps

Job Summary

Job Description

Microsoft is seeking a Software Engineer to contribute to the implementation of client build, release, and validation gating, and support feature flighting across multiple platforms, devices, and operating systems. The role involves designing, developing, and maintaining engineering infrastructure, tools, and services powering CI/CD for Microsoft Teams. Responsibilities include championing best practices for a quality-focused release process, building tools to ensure safe and quality releases, improving developer productivity, and contributing ideas to improve systems. The ideal candidate possesses strong problem-solving skills, experience with CI/CD practices, and a passion for automation testing at scale. The position requires collaboration with partner teams and a drive to improve processes.
Must have:
  • Bachelor's Degree in CS or related field
  • Experience in C, C++, C#, Java, JavaScript, or Python
  • CI/CD familiarity
  • Design, develop, and maintain CI/CD infrastructure
  • Champion best practices for quality releases
  • Build tools for safe and quality releases
Good to have:
  • Strong sense of software craftsmanship
  • Experience pushing code to production
  • Passion for automation testing at large scale
  • Excellent problem-solving and debugging skills
  • Ability to work collaboratively with partner teams
Perks:
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Networking opportunities

Job Details

Overview

Microsoft’s mission is to empower every person and every organization on the planet to achieve more. As employees we come together with a growth mindset, innovate to empower others, and collaborate to realize our shared goals. Each day we build on our values of respect, integrity, and accountability to create a culture of inclusion where everyone can thrive at work and beyond.


We are looking for a Software Engineer to contribute to implementation of client build, release, and validation gating and support feature flighting across multiple platforms, devices, and operating systems. Our infrastructure allows partner teams to safely deliver a new feature to millions of users in the order of minutes in an automated fashion.

Qualifications

Required Qualifications:

  • Bachelor's Degree in Computer Science, or related technical discipline with proven experience co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python
    • OR equivalent experience.
  • Familiar with CI/CD practices and ready to apply them.

Other Requirements:

 

Ability to meet Microsoft, customer and/or government security screening requirements are required for this role. These requirements include but are not limited to the following specialized security screenings:

  •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ud background check upon hire/transfer and every two years thereafter.

Preferred Qualifications:

  • You have a strong sense of craftsmanship in the solutions you create and an idea about how software should and should not be built & released.
  • You’re not afraid to push the code to production.
  • You believe that a task worth doing is a task worth automating.
  • You seek opportunities to learn new skills and technologies.
  • Passionate about automation testing at large scale.
  • Excellent problem-solving & debugging skills.
  • Good track record of working with partner teams and a mindset to get things done the right way.
  • Self-motivated with a drive for reaching across teams and organizations to make progress collaboratively.

 

Responsibilities

  • Design, develop and maintain engineering infrastructure, tools and services that power the CI/CD for Microsoft Teams across different clients/platforms.
  • Champion best practices, tools, and processes for a data-driven, quality-focused release of Microsoft Teams as frequently as possible to our customers.
  • Build tools/bots to ensure safe and quality releases, improve developer productivity, contribute ideas to continuously improve our systems and drive actionable feedback on code and product quality.
Benefits/perks listed below may vary depending on the nature of your employment with Microsoft and the country where you work.
Industry leading healthcare
Educational resources
Discounts on products and services
Savings and investments
Maternity and paternity leave
Generous time away
Giving programs
Opportunities to network and connect

Similar Jobs

Canva - Staff Backend Software Engineer (Java) - Canva Ecosystem

Canva

Perth, Western Australia, Australia (Remote)
1 Day ago
Aristocrat Gaming - Technical Artist II

Aristocrat Gaming

Gurugram, Haryana, India (Hybrid)
2 Months ago
N-iX - Senior Full Stack Engineer (Java+React)

N-iX

Bulgaria (Remote)
1 Month ago
Aristocrat Gaming - DevOps Lead

Aristocrat Gaming

Austin, Texas, United States (Hybrid)
2 Weeks ago
King - Data Science Intern - Summer 2025

King

London, England, United Kingdom (On-Site)
3 Weeks ago
SYBO - Build and Release Engineering Intern

SYBO

Copenhagen, Denmark (On-Site)
1 Week ago
Axinous - Sr. Staff Software Engineer

Axinous

California, United States (Remote)
2 Days ago
Lost Boys Interactive - Senior DevOps Engineer

Lost Boys Interactive

(Remote)
1 Month ago
PwC - IN_Associate_Azure Cloud Data Engineer_OneCloud _Advisory _Bangalore

PwC

Gurugram, Haryana, India (On-Site)
2 Months ago
Wargaming - Senior Infrastructure Engineer (Python) (Game Engine Development Team)

Wargaming

Nicosia, Nicosia, Cyprus (Hybrid)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Paypal - Machine Learning Engineer

Paypal

San Jose, California, United States (Hybrid)
4 Months ago
Google - Software Engineer, PhD, Early Career, Campus, Machine Learning, Systems and Cloud AI, 2025 start

Google

Sunnyvale, California, United States (On-Site)
1 Month ago
N-iX - SENIOR FULL STACK ENGINEER (JAVA+REACT) (#2720)

N-iX

Ukraine (Remote)
1 Month ago
Google - Senior Software Engineer, Ads

Google

Warsaw, Masovian Voivodeship, Poland (On-Site)
3 Months ago
Revalsys Technologies - Performance Tester

Revalsys Technologies

Hyderabad, Telangana, India (On-Site)
3 Months ago
Wizcorp - Game Server Programmer

Wizcorp

Tokyo, Japan (Remote)
4 Months ago
Tencent - Forex Application Development Intern - Singapore 900071

Tencent

Singapore (On-Site)
1 Month ago
Tencent - WeChat Tech Intern (Backend Developer)

Tencent

(On-Site)
3 Months ago
ByteDance - Senior Backend Software Engineer, Product Supply

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Highspot - Sr. Full Stack Engineer, Training & Coaching

Highspot

Hyderabad, Telangana, India (Hybrid)
4 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Prague, Prague, Czechia

Evolution - Studio and Audio Support Specialist

Evolution

Prague, Prague, Czechia (On-Site)
3 Months ago
Warhorse Studios - Producent/Project Manager

Warhorse Studios

Prague, Prague, Czechia (On-Site)
3 Months ago
MADFINGER Games - Senior Gameplay Programmer - Unreal

MADFINGER Games

Brno, South Moravian Region, Czechia (On-Site)
3 Months ago
PwC - Actuarial Specialist in Audit Department

PwC

Prague, Prague, Czechia (On-Site)
4 Months ago
PwC - Senior Consultant - Technology Consulting - Financial Sector

PwC

Prague, Prague, Czechia (On-Site)
4 Months ago
Warhorse Studios - C++ Programmer

Warhorse Studios

Prague, Prague, Czechia (On-Site)
6 Months ago
CloudLinux - Lead SDET/QA Automation Engineer at CloudLinux (worldwide remote, work anywhere)

CloudLinux

Prague, Prague, Czechia (Remote)
3 Months ago
Wargaming - Game Developer (World of Tanks)

Wargaming

Prague, Prague, Czechia (Hybrid)
3 Months ago
Rockstar Games - Marketing Manager - Japan

Rockstar Games

Jihomoravský Kraj, Czechia (On-Site)
1 Month ago
PwC - Data Engineer - Financial Crime team

PwC

Prague, Prague, Czechia (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

DevOps Jobs

ECI - Cloud Services Engineer

ECI

Indore, Madhya Pradesh, India (On-Site)
3 Months ago
Trend Micro - Sr. Engineer

Trend Micro

Taipei City, Taiwan (On-Site)
4 Months ago
ByteDance - Software Engineer, SRE - Platform Services

ByteDance

San Jose, California, United States (On-Site)
1 Week ago
Warner Bros Discovery - Staff Software Engineer - AWS Architecture (Observability Team),Bangalore

Warner Bros Discovery

Bengaluru, Karnataka, India (On-Site)
3 Months ago
Inworld AI - Staff Platform Engineer  - Canada

Inworld AI

Vancouver, British Columbia, Canada (On-Site)
2 Months ago
Ubisoft - Engine Programmer [Snowdrop]

Ubisoft

Bucharest, Bucharest, Romania (Hybrid)
3 Months ago
Luxoft - KDB Developer

Luxoft

Chennai, Tamil Nadu, India (On-Site)
3 Months ago
Fortis Games - DevOps Engineer II

Fortis Games

Portugal (On-Site)
3 Months ago
Netomi - Devops Engineer - II

Netomi

Gurugram, Haryana, India (Remote)
2 Months ago
Sigma Software - Senior Java Developer

Sigma Software

Warsaw, Masovian Voivodeship, Poland (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Microsoft is a tech giant that develops, licenses, and supports a range of software products, services, and devices.

Mountain View, California, United States (Hybrid)

Mountain View, California, United States (Hybrid)

Mountain View, California, United States (Hybrid)

New York, New York, United States (Hybrid)

Mountain View, California, United States (Hybrid)

Mountain View, California, United States (Hybrid)

London, England, United Kingdom (On-Site)

Dublin, County Dublin, Ireland (On-Site)

Mountain View, California, United States (Hybrid)

View All Jobs

Get notified when new jobs are added by Microsoft

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ug